随着移动互联网的快速发展,许多企业纷纷寻找专业app定制开发公司开展合作,开发自己的软件。但是寻找软件开发公司开发app的时候一定要注意以下细节。
一、app开发前期
1.需求明确
计划做一个app应该有一个明确的定位和需求分析。例如,建立项目目标受众、产品定位以及他们是否经历过市场调查,以及是否对调查结果进行了深入的分析。如果这项工作已经完成,并完成了完整的需求分析文档,这对于在中后期找到一家外包公司是非常重要的。
2.沟通很重要
功能性需求确认后,UI页面设计,app页面设计,此时需要与app开发公司进行讨论。高效的沟通对彼此来说是非常必要的,需要不断的沟通才能让对方掌握自己喜欢的,并提出一些页面设计的专业建议。沟通在代码开发层面也起着重要的作用。
3.谨防受骗
目前,市场上的外包服务良莠不齐。有些外包服务很可能没有研发水平,只能通过重新分包来实施项目,这不仅会导致项目进度的延误,还会使产品和需求不符。因此,在与第三方公司签订合同时,必须在协议中注明“禁止分包”这几个字,以及相应的代价。
4.费用预算
如果没有了解需求就告诉你开发app要多少钱无疑是骗人的,因为app项目成本与需求及其复杂性密切相关。单一要求、逻辑性简单的app开发费用肯定比要求复杂、逻辑复杂的便宜。app项目成本与各种因素有关,但一开口就告诉你要花多少钱开发的公司是不可靠的。
二、app开发中期
1.功能对接清晰
手机屏幕很小,所有的实际操作都很麻烦,所以在设计中不要把一些相关的选择功能分开,客户找不到不用说,即使找到也没法很好的实际操作。因此,开发人员在研发中必须注意这种情况。
2.功能键不能太小
许多智能手机app点击一个按钮大部分时间没有反映,怎么会这样,根本原因是按钮太小或按钮可以点击类别太小,客户没有点击,所以在开发中所有功能按钮都可以点击类别不能太小,以防止客户不能点击导致麻烦。
3.提醒客户
许多app在加载或使用其他功能时没有提醒客户,这种感觉很不好,不个性化,因为不可能所有客户都知道app如何使用,有什么效果。因此,建议在开发中进行提醒功能,如网页加载,请稍等,或支付让消费者确认是否真的支付这些。
4.隐藏功能设置
在app为了突出巨大的产品卖点,许多开发人员通常选择向消费者展示所有的功能,事实上,这不推荐。最好使用常用功能,常见的基本功能,一些不必要的功能隐藏或放在主次位置,以免引起客户体验。
三、app开发后期
1.交付验收
双方如何进行交付验收,完成什么样的标准,应在初步沟通中要求,交付验收必须以书面形式进行。
2.专利权
交付后的知识产权归属需事先作出承诺。
3.信息保密
部分客户会与开发公司签订保密合同,承诺合同规定和本合同涉及项目的所有相关文件绝对保密,未经许可不得泄露。
4.售后服务
更新、维护保养、学习培训。app升级问题,开发公司在售后服务中给予多长时间的保修,app如何完成维护和优化,双方必须做好书面形式标准。